Claims
- 1. In a body stimulation system of the type having external means for generating and transmitting radio frequency programming signals and implantable means, the implantable means including signal generator means with at least one programmable operating characteristic and means responsive to received programming signals for establishing said programmable operating characteristic in predetermined correspondence therewith; a housing enclosing said signal generator; and output means for delivering stimulation signals to a desired body site including stimulation delivering lead means extending from said housing, the improvement wherein said lead means comprises means connected to said operating characteristic establishing means for receiving said programming signals.
- 2. The body stimulation system of claim 1 wherein said external means comprises means for preventing the transmission of programming signals during a stimulation signal.
- 3. The body stimulation system of claim 2 wherein said transmission preventing means comprises means for preventing transmission of programming signals for a predetermined period following a stimulation signal.
- 4. The body stimulation system of claim 1 comprising means for activating said external means during the refractory period of the tissue at said desired body site.
- 5. The body stimulation system of claim 1 comprising means for rendering said output parameter establishing means responsive to received programming signals only during the occurrence of second externally generated signals having characteristics discriminable from the characteristics of said programming signals.
- 6. The body stimulation system of claim 5 wherein said programming signals comprise radio frequency signals and said second signal comprises magnetic signals.
- 7. The body stimulation system of claim 5 wherein said signal generator means comprises pulse generator means, said pulse generator means operating at a fixed rate during said second externally generated signals.
- 8. The body stimulation system of claim 7 wherein said external means comprises means for preventing the transmission of programming signals during a stimulation signal.
- 9. The body stimulation system of claim 8 wherein said transmission preventing means comprising means for preventing transmission of programming signals for a predetermined period following a stimulation signal.
- 10. The body stimulation system of claim 9 wherein said programming signals comprise radio frequency signals and said second signal comprises magnetic signals.
- 11. The body stimulation system of claim 7 comprising means for activating said external means during the refractory period of the tissue at said desired body site.
